The Science of Melting Chocolate

To understand why chocolate hardens in the microwave, we first need to delve into the science behind chocolate melting. Chocolate is a complex mixture of cocoa solids, cocoa butter, sugar, and in some cases, milk solids or other ingredients. Different types of chocolate—dark, milk, and white—each behave uniquely when heated due to varying cocoa butter content and sugar concentrations.

The Cocoa Butter Composition

Cocoa butter is the fat component of chocolate and plays a vital role in forming its texture. When heated, cocoa butter melts at a relatively low temperature (approximately 30-38°C or 86-100°F), allowing chocolate to smoothly transition from solid to liquid. However, excessive or uneven heating can cause cocoa butter crystals to reform improperly, resulting in a hard, gritty texture.

The Role of Sugar and Moisture

In addition to cocoa butter, sugar is an essential ingredient that can impact the melting process. When chocolate is heated too quickly, the sugar can crystallize, causing the texture to become grainy and hard. Moisture is another critical factor; any water introduced into the chocolate—even in small amounts—can cause chocolate to seize, forming clumps that can turn hard rather than staying silky and smooth.

Common Reasons Chocolate Hardens in the Microwave

Understanding the following reasons will help you master the melting process:

1. Overheating Chocolate

One of the primary reasons chocolate hardens in the microwave is overheating. When chocolate is exposed to high temperatures, it can burn, which changes its molecular structure and leads to a hard texture.

2. Uneven Heating

Microwaves do not always heat evenly, leading to hot spots that can burn parts of the chocolate while leaving others solid. This inconsistency can lead to portions of chocolate becoming hard while others melt smoothly.

3. Introducing Moisture

As mentioned earlier, moisture is the enemy of melted chocolate. Even small drops of water from a spoon, bowl, or ingredient can trigger clumping. Moisture causes sugar to dissolve unevenly, leading to a grainy texture and hardened chocolate.

4. Incorrect Type of Chocolate

Different types of chocolate have varied melting points. For example, chocolate chips are designed to hold their shape when heated, which makes them more challenging to melt smoothly in a microwave. In contrast, bars of chocolate may melt completely but are more prone to burning if left unattended.

5. Improper Containers

Using the wrong kind of container can also affect the melting process. Metal containers in a microwave can create arcing, while glass containers that are not microwave-safe can crack or shatter. It’s essential to use microwave-safe glass or ceramic bowls for best results.

How to Melt Chocolate Successfully in the Microwave

Now that we’ve identified the problems, let’s focus on optimal practices to melt chocolate perfectly every time.

Step-by-Step Guide to Melting Chocolate

  1. Choose the Right Chocolate:
  2. Always select high-quality chocolate bars or melting wafers. If using chocolate chips, remember they may require special attention.

  3. Break It Down:

  4. Chop solid chocolate into small, uniform pieces to ensure even melting. This step can prevent overheating and promote consistent results.

  5. Use a Suitable Bowl:

  6. Opt for a microwave-safe glass or ceramic bowl. Avoid plastic, as it can warp and sometimes release harmful chemicals.

  7. Set the Microwave Temperature:

  8. Use a low power setting (about 50% power or medium). This helps to reduce the risk of burning chocolate.

  9. Microwaving in Intervals:

  10. Microwave the chocolate in short bursts of 20 to 30 seconds. Remove the bowl and stir between intervals to allow the heat to distribute evenly.

  11. Check Consistency:

  12. Once most of the chocolate appears melted, stop microwaving even if small lumps remain. The residual heat will continue to melt these tiny pieces.

  13. Avoid Water:

  14. Make sure all tools and containers are completely dry before use. Avoid cooking chocolate in humid conditions as well.

What to Do If Your Chocolate Hardens

If you find yourself facing hardened chocolate despite all precautions, don’t despair! Here are steps to salvage it:

1. Use a Small Amount of Fat

Incorporating a small amount of vegetable oil, cocoa butter, or even butter can help reintroduce moisture and smoothen out the chocolate. Start with a teaspoon and gradually mix it in.

2. Reheat Using a Double Boiler Method

If microwave melting fails, transferring to a double boiler is an alternative. Heat water in a pot to a simmer, place the hardened chocolate in a heat-proof bowl over the pot, and allow it to melt slowly.

3. Avoid Adding Water

While some may think adding a bit of water may help salvage overheated chocolate, this often worsens the situation and leads to further seizing.

How can I properly melt chocolate in the microwave?

To melt chocolate perfectly in the microwave, start by breaking it into small, even pieces and placing it in a microwave-safe bowl. This ensures that the chocolate melts uniformly and reduces the risk of overheating. Set your microwave to a low power setting, typically around 50% power, and heat the chocolate in short bursts of 20 to 30 seconds. After each burst, stir the chocolate to help distribute the heat and prevent hot spots.

Continue this process until the chocolate is mostly melted, leaving a few small unmelted pieces. These remnants will melt completely when you stir the mixture, preventing any chance of burning. Remember to be patient; melting chocolate is a delicate process that requires careful attention to temperature and time.

Does adding anything to chocolate help with melting?

Yes, adding a small amount of fat, like vegetable oil or coconut oil, can help chocolate melt more smoothly and remain fluid after melting. The fats help create a better consistency by preventing the chocolate from seizing and allowing it to retain a glossy appearance when cooled. For every cup of chocolate, adding about a teaspoon of oil can yield great results.

However, be cautious with the amount you add, as excess fat can affect the chocolate’s texture and flavor. Always choose fats that complement the chocolate, and consider that flavored oils may impart additional tastes. This method is especially useful for chocolate that is intended for dipping, coating, or drizzling, as it keeps the chocolate smooth and easy to work with.
